[Mpuls-commits] r442 - in wasko/trunk: formed waskaweb/controllers

scm-commit@wald.intevation.org scm-commit at wald.intevation.org
Mon Mar 30 10:07:46 CEST 2009


Author: torsten
Date: 2009-03-30 10:07:44 +0200 (Mon, 30 Mar 2009)
New Revision: 442

Modified:
   wasko/trunk/formed/formedtree_web.xml
   wasko/trunk/waskaweb/controllers/caselifetime.py
Log:
New formedtree


Modified: wasko/trunk/formed/formedtree_web.xml
===================================================================
--- wasko/trunk/formed/formedtree_web.xml	2009-03-27 14:57:28 UTC (rev 441)
+++ wasko/trunk/formed/formedtree_web.xml	2009-03-30 08:07:44 UTC (rev 442)
@@ -112,8 +112,8 @@
                 <bool description="unbekannt" name="bool-395" value="-3"/>
                 <bool checked="true" description="keine Angabe" name="bool-343" value="-1"/>
               </choice>
-              <group containers="a" description="Angaben bei erfolgreicher Reeintegration" name="group-112" target="c">
-                <choice description="Wohin erfolgte die Reintegration?" name="cm_dok_end_verm" size="1" target="a">
+              <conditional expr="$cm_dok_end_art isset $cm_dok_end_art 1 == and" invisible="true" name="conditional-6" target="c">
+                <choice description="Wohin erfolgte die Reintegration?" name="cm_dok_end_verm" size="1" target="c">
                   <bool description="Ursprungsklasse" name="bool-344" value="1"/>
                   <bool description="gleiche Schule, neue Klasse" name="bool-345" value="2"/>
                   <bool description="andere Schule" name="bool-346" value="3"/>
@@ -121,9 +121,9 @@
                   <bool description="Sonstiges" name="bool-347" value="-2"/>
                   <bool checked="true" description="keine Angabe" name="bool-347" value="-1"/>
                 </choice>
-              </group>
-              <group containers="a,b" description="Angaben bei sonstiger Beendigung" name="group-111" target="d">
-                <choice description="Gründe für sonstige Beendigung" name="cm_dok_end_sonst" size="1" target="a">
+              </conditional>
+              <conditional expr="$cm_dok_end_art isset $cm_dok_end_art 2 == and" invisible="true" name="conditional-7" target="d">
+                <choice description="Gründe für sonstige Beendigung" name="cm_dok_end_sonst" size="1" target="d">
                   <bool description="Umzug" name="bool-349" value="1"/>
                   <bool description="Schwangerschaft" name="bool-349" value="2"/>
                   <bool description="Krankheit" name="bool-349" value="3"/>
@@ -134,20 +134,18 @@
                   <bool description="Sonstiges" name="bool-349" value="-2"/>
                   <bool checked="true" description="keine Angabe" name="bool-349" value="-1"/>
                 </choice>
-              </group>
+              </conditional>
               <rule description="'cm_dok_datum_beendigung' muss vor 'cm_wiederauf_datum_bis_1' liegen." expr="$cm_dok_datum_beendigung isset $cm_dok_datum_beendigung known and $cm_wiederauf_datum_bis_1 isset $cm_wiederauf_datum_bis_1 known and and $cm_dok_datum_beendigung $cm_wiederauf_datum_bis_1 &gt; and not" name="date-sequence-rule-26" value="'Angaben zur bereits erfolgten Beendigung der Betreuung / Datum der Beendigung' darf zeitlich nicht nach 'Wiederaufnahme der/des Jugendlichen für 3 Monate / Datum Wiederaufnahme genehmigt bis' liegen."/>
               <rule description="'cm_dok_datum_beendigung' muss vor 'cm_wiederauf_genehm_datum_1' liegen." expr="$cm_dok_datum_beendigung isset $cm_dok_datum_beendigung known and $cm_wiederauf_genehm_datum_1 isset $cm_wiederauf_genehm_datum_1 known and and $cm_dok_datum_beendigung $cm_wiederauf_genehm_datum_1 &gt; and not" name="date-sequence-rule-43" value="'Angaben zur bereits erfolgten Beendigung der Betreuung / Datum der Beendigung' darf zeitlich nicht nach 'Wiederaufnahme der/des Jugendlichen für 3 Monate / Datum Genehmigung der Wiederaufnahme' liegen."/>
               <rule description="'cm_dok_datum_beendigung' muss vor 'cm_wiederauf_datum_bis_2' liegen." expr="$cm_dok_datum_beendigung isset $cm_dok_datum_beendigung known and $cm_wiederauf_datum_bis_2 isset $cm_wiederauf_datum_bis_2 known and and $cm_dok_datum_beendigung $cm_wiederauf_datum_bis_2 &gt; and not" name="date-sequence-rule-71" value="'Angaben zur bereits erfolgten Beendigung der Betreuung / Datum der Beendigung' darf zeitlich nicht nach 'Wiederaufnahme der/des Jugendlichen für weitere 3 Monate / Datum Wiederaufnahme genehmigt bis' liegen."/>
             </group>
             <conditional expr="$cm_neuauf_genehm isset $cm_neuauf_genehm -1 != and" invisible="true" name="conditional-5" target="c">
-              <group description="Neuaufnahme der/des Jugendlichen" name="group-114" target="c">
-                <choice description="Genehmigung der Neuaufnahme" name="cm_neuauf_genehm" size="1">
-                  <bool description="ja" name="bool-411" value="1"/>
-                  <bool description="nein" name="bool-411" value="0"/>
-                  <bool description="unbekannt" name="bool-411" value="-3"/>
-                  <bool checked="true" description="keine Angabe" name="bool-411" value="-1"/>
-                </choice>
-              </group>
+              <choice description="Genehmigung der Neuaufnahme" name="cm_neuauf_genehm" size="1" target="c">
+                <bool description="ja" name="bool-411" value="1"/>
+                <bool description="nein" name="bool-411" value="0"/>
+                <bool description="unbekannt" name="bool-411" value="-3"/>
+                <bool checked="true" description="keine Angabe" name="bool-411" value="-1"/>
+              </choice>
             </conditional>
             <conditional expr="$cm_wiederauf_genehm_1 isset $cm_wiederauf_genehm_1 -1 != and" invisible="true" name="conditional-1" target="d">
               <group containers="a,b" description="Wiederaufnahme der/des Jugendlichen für 3 Monate" name="group-109" target="d">

Modified: wasko/trunk/waskaweb/controllers/caselifetime.py
===================================================================
--- wasko/trunk/waskaweb/controllers/caselifetime.py	2009-03-27 14:57:28 UTC (rev 441)
+++ wasko/trunk/waskaweb/controllers/caselifetime.py	2009-03-30 08:07:44 UTC (rev 442)
@@ -188,7 +188,7 @@
 
 
     # Verlängerung anzeigen 
-    if not c.disable_all and c.phase in (2,) and c.num_verlaengerung < 1 and c.num_wiederaufnahme < 1:
+    if not c.disable_all and c.phase in (2,) and c.num_verlaengerung < 2 and c.num_wiederaufnahme < 1:
         c.show_verlaengerung = True
     else: 
         c.show_verlaengerung = False



More information about the Mpuls-commits mailing list